There are two irreversible public art setups on the Island: Edward Hanlan, a law located at Hanlan's Point Ferryboat Dock Fire and Water, a clock situated on the tower of the station house on Ward's Island Go to the Public Art Map. Toronto parking for more details. At over 200 years of ages, the Gibraltar Factor Lighthouse is the oldest rock building in Toronto and copyright's oldest standing lighthouse


Parts of Toronto Island are Ecologically Substantial Areas, and a variety of migrating birds can be detected in the spring and fall. Secret locations to see for bird-watching including: On Hanlan's Point, near the huge willows along the flight terminal fence Near Gibaltar Point, at the dunes and Trout Pond At the Nature Reserve north of the water filtration plant At Snug Harbour At Snake Island In the southeast part of Ward's Island Dune and beaches run the size of the western coast of Toronto Island Park from Hanlan's Factor to Gibraltar Factor, in addition to Ward's Island.

Overnight camping is not enabled on Toronto Island Park. Exceptions use for non-profit groups when acquiring a single permit for Serpent Island. Centreville offers over 30 rides and tourist attractions.

Centre Island Coastline (Manitou Coastline) is a 10-minute stroll southern from Centre Island Ferry Dock. Toronto parking. A portion of this coastline is clothing-optional.


6 Simple Techniques For Toronto Weather


Coastlines are monitored by a lifeguard and preserved in the summertime. Swimming without a lifeguard is not suggested. 2 splash pads are on Centre Island toronto in british columbia that run from May to September. One dash pad is located within Centreville Theme park and users do not require to pay an entry fee to Centreville or acquisition tickets to utilize it.




Centre Island pier provides views of the islands, Tommy Thompson Park and Toronto's city skyline. It's located at Centre Island Coastline. The land that the CN Tower bases on was reclaimed from Lake Ontario, the coasts and waters of which were a meeting point for numerous Nations, consisting of the Mississaugas of the Credit, the Anishinaabe, the Chippewa, the Haudenosaunee, and the Wendat individuals. And currently, this land is home to lots of diverse Initial Countries, Inuit and Mtis individuals.
